A certification in Certified Professional in Nanofiber Nanorods equips individuals with comprehensive knowledge and practical skills in the rapidly evolving field of nanomaterials. The program focuses on the synthesis, characterization, and applications of nanofibers and nanorods, crucial for advancements in diverse sectors.


Learning outcomes typically include mastering techniques for nanofiber and nanorod fabrication, including electrospinning, self-assembly, and template synthesis. Participants gain proficiency in advanced characterization methods like electron microscopy and spectroscopy, essential for analyzing the structure and properties of these nanoscale materials. Understanding the applications of nanofibers and nanorods in areas like filtration, biomedical engineering, and energy storage is a key component.
